Oliver Phelps
NameOliver Phelps
OccupationActor
Known forHarry Potter film series

Oliver Phelps is a British actor, best known for his role as George Weasley in the Harry Potter film series, alongside his twin brother James Phelps, who played Fred Weasley. He was born on February 25, 1986, in Sutton Coldfield, Birmingham, England, to Susan Phelps and Martyn Phelps. Oliver Phelps' acting career began at a young age, with his first major role in the Harry Potter film series, which was based on the books by J.K. Rowling and produced by Warner Bros. Pictures.
